Is It Right To Publish The Photo Of A Child Pornography Collector |
|
If the collector was only 17 years old himself?
There was a story in Newsday a few days ago about two young men, aged 17 and 18, who were arrested for having child pornography, I believe, stored in their lockers at school.
I can understand them being arrested, I have no problem with that, but to have their photos published in the paper - before they were even convicted, just kinda struck me the wrong way.
Plus one of them was 17. I always assumed there were laws against divulging the names of minors involved in crimes, and most certainly their photos.
Thoughts?
